This segment from the November 30, 1984, episode of the series “Louisiana: The State We’re In” features Robyn Ekings’ report on the negative reaction of environmentalists to Governor Edwin Edwards’ appointment of Jim Porter as the new Secretary of the Department of Natural Resources (DNR) following the resignation of William Huls. Ekings reports that environmentalists feel that the state favors oil and gas interests over environmental concerns, that coastal zone management should be moved from DNR to the Department of Environmental Quality, and that DNR discourages public input. Ekings interviews: Ross Vincent of the Ecology Center; DNR Secretary Jim Porter; and Bill Bailey, the Vice President of the Louisiana Mid-Continent Oil and Gas Association. Host: Beth Courtney
